MaggieFrame magnetic hoops embroidery are innovative machine embroidery hoops for your YONTHIN embroidery Machines! These magnet hoops are designed to make embroider easier, more efficient, and more enjoyable than ever before.

Packing List:

1. Hoop Main Part x 1 pcs
2. Metal Brackets x 1 pair
3. Screws & Screwdriver
(Note: Brackets will be matched according to your machine brand, and need to be assembled on hoop main part with screws)

Watch video

Compatible with YONTHIN Embroidery Machine Models.

For YONTHIN YX-M1201 / YXD1201/ YX-M1202/ YX-M1204/ YX-M1206 etc. MaggieFrame has 17 hoop sizes to compatible with different machine models of YONTHIN Embroidery Machines. Click Here to check all 17 sizes for YONTHIN.

FAQs

Will the strong magnets interfere with my YONTHIN embroidery machine's electronics?

No, MaggieFrame magnetic hoops are 100% safe for YONTHIN embroidery machines. The magnet field is focused within the hoop’s working area and will not interfere with electronics or the computer system if used normally. Just avoid placing the magnetic hoop directly over the machine’s control panel or electronic box for extended periods.

How can I confirm whether this MaggieFrame bracket fits my machine arm spacing?

Measure your embroidery machine’s arm spacing (or sewing arm width) in inches or millimeters, or refer to your user manual. Compare the measurement with the specifications provided on our product page for the MaggieFrame magnetic hoop 12.6″ × 3.9″ (320 × 100 mm). If you’re unsure, please contact our support team for guidance before installation.

What is the best way to clean spray adhesive residue from the hoop?

For safe cleaning, use a soft cloth lightly moistened with rubbing alcohol or a mild citrus-based cleaner. Wipe along the magnet surface and metal frame to remove sticky residues. Avoid soaking the hoop or using harsh chemical solvents that may damage the magnetic surface or cause corrosion over time.

How can I maintain hoop tension and alignment when using this magnetic embroidery frame?

To keep fabrics flat and stable with the MaggieFrame magnetic hoop, ensure your fabric is evenly smoothed before placing the top magnetic frame. The magnets will grip the fabric securely without excessive pressure, preventing hoop marks. Regularly check that the metal brackets and screws are tight for consistent embroidery alignment on your YONTHIN embroidery machine.

A stark, brutish "Petulia" with a pistol in its pocket
It's about time this movie got released on DVD. It's odd that a film could spawn a remake ("Payback"), a glib nod ("Grosse Pointe Blank") and countless homages ("The Limey," among others) and still be as underseen as "Point Blank." The lack of a disc certainly didn't help its low profile, but of course this is a challenging, idiosyncratic movie, even three decades later. The plot is simple -- a crook is betrayed by his wife and partner and spends the rest of the movie trying to get what he's owed -- but the editing and narrative structure is unusual. What in the world did audiences possibly make of this back when it was first released? It's a remarkable film, as startling and innovative as Richard Lester's "Petulia," although admittedly it's thematically much less complex. This edition is excellent, too. Great sound, great picture and a fantastic commentary by director John Boorman and big-time "Point" fan Steven Soderbergh, who laughingly admits to Boorman that he's ripped this movie off more than a few times. Their chat is more technical than gossipy and deals heavily with the editing, the production (the script was only 70 pages long), the studio's concerns about the picture, the actors, violence, surrealism (is it all a dream?) and Boorman's elaborate use of color (the tones of clothing and sets intensify over the course of the film). I've gotten a lot of good DVD's this year but in terms of content, presentation and extas, this is one of the best.

A forerunner to Dirty Harry and Lee Marvin shining...
If you liked "The Getaway" or "Dirty Harry", then meet their forerunner. "Point Blank" is explosive, fast-paced, and still the acting is there. Good acting that is. Lee Marvin is at his best. Angie Dickinson. in her strong performance, is as beautiful as ever. Keenan Wynn and Carroll O'Connor play their parts to the hilt and it truly shows. John Vernon (who was The Mayor in "Dirty Harry") plays a slimy type with diligence and very believable. Add the killing pace of the entire picture, and you have a hot item, as sharp and cutting as "Film Noir" can be. Yes, because this is still a "Film Noir", despite the fact that it was filmed in Color and in the mid-sixties. John Boorman ("Hell in the Pacific", "Deliverance" and "The Emerald Forest"), skillfully "color coded" the entire movie, bringing it from absolute colors at the beginning, to more red-tinted ones towards the end. The only difference from a true "Film Noir" is its fast-paced storyline, that would lead us to movies as I have mentioned above. Marvin's minimalistic acting, but forceful presence, is enough to fill every frame of the movie with tension, action and complete mayhem. Compare him in "The Dirty Dozen" and "The Big Red One" and you will see what I mean. A big plus was the release on DVD. An excellent transfer with a sharp picture resolution, a clearcut sound, make it a very enticing experience to watch it at home. This is not just a Highly Recommended title. It is simply a Must!
